Oyasukyo Onsen
Enjoy the seasonal beauty of the gorge from a hot spring nestled in steep cliffs
Located in the city of Yuzawa City in Akita Prefecture, Oyasukyo Gorge has V-shaped cliffs resulting from the erosion of the rapid currents of the Minase River over centuries. In contrast to the gorge's beauty in each season, there is Oyasukyo Daifunto where boiling underground water fiercely sprouts out with a gushing sound from the cracks at the bottom of the valley. At the Oyasukyo hot spring village nearby, visitors can soak in the steaming hot spring water sourced from Oyasukyo Daifunto. Along the valley are also natural open-air baths that allow you to enjoy breathtaking views of the gorge.

Hot spring waters where cranes came to be healed
Sourced from spring waters gushing out from the gorge, Oyasukyo Onsen has a long history as a hot spring cure since the Edo Period (1603-1868). Legend has it that the hot spring was discovered as cranes were coming to heal their wounds in the waters. There are two types of water gushing out from four different sources, and the temperate can rise up to 95 degrees. The village is lined with traditional hot spring inns. Some of them even offer foot baths and spring water for drinking.
